A Professional Certificate in Microbiome Engineering provides specialized training in manipulating microbial communities for various applications. This intensive program equips students with the cutting-edge skills needed to thrive in this rapidly expanding field.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of microbiome analysis techniques, including metagenomics and bioinformatics. Students will also master the principles of microbiome engineering, developing skills in microbial community manipulation, and synthetic biology relevant to microbiome applications. Graduates will be capable of designing and implementing microbiome-based solutions for diverse industries.
The program duration typically spans several months, often delivered through a flexible online learning platform, making it accessible to working professionals. The curriculum combines theoretical knowledge with practical, hands-on experience through projects and case studies reflecting real-world challenges.
The industry relevance of a Microbiome Engineering certificate is substantial. This rapidly evolving field offers ample opportunities across various sectors. Graduates will be well-prepared for roles in pharmaceuticals, agriculture, environmental remediation, food science, and personalized medicine, contributing to innovations in areas such as drug discovery, probiotics development, and sustainable agriculture practices. Opportunities in research and development are also plentiful.
The program’s focus on computational tools, coupled with the practical application of microbiome engineering principles, ensures graduates are highly sought-after professionals with expertise in gut microbiome, microbial ecology, and microbial genomics.
